Chapter 7. System Settings
301
Backup
To back up system configuration settings, do the following:
1. (Optional) In the Backup panel, check Add Password, and provide a
password for the backup file.
Note: Providing a password is a security feature – if you provide a
password, you will need to give the same password in order to
restore the configuration settings from this file.
2. Click Backup.
3. In the dialog box that comes up, Click Save to save the configuration file
(System.conf) to a location on your hard disk.
4. Navigate to the directory where you want to save the file and click Save.
Restore
To restore system configuration settings, do the following:
1. In the Restore panel, click Browse.
2. Navigate to the directory where the backup file is located and select it.
3. When you return to the Backup/Restore page enter the password you set
when the backup file was created.
Note: If you did not set a password for the file, leave the field blank.
4. Click Restore.
5. Click OK to confirm that you want to restore the configuration data.
When the Restore procedure is in process, a message stating that the KVM
over IP Matrix Manager will restart will appear. After a short while the
KVM over IP Matrix Manager closes and refreshes at the log in screen.
When it comes back up the configuration settings that were restored from
the backup file are in effect.
